相關(guān)單詞:
1. dehydration:脫水,與heat exhaustion相似,都與水分有關(guān)。
2. fatigue:疲勞,表示身體因過(guò)度使用或壓力而感到疲倦。
3. collapse:倒塌,指身體因過(guò)度勞累或炎熱而突然失去平衡或支撐力。
4. weakness:虛弱,表示身體因疾病、疲勞或缺乏營(yíng)養(yǎng)而變得無(wú)力。
5. depletion:耗盡,與heat exhaustion中的exhaustion含義相似,表示資源的消耗。
6. heatstroke:中暑,與heat exhaustion相對(duì),表示更嚴(yán)重的熱相關(guān)疾病。
7. humidity:濕度,與熱的環(huán)境有關(guān),可以導(dǎo)致身體不適。
8. thermoregulation:體溫調(diào)節(jié),與熱相關(guān),指身體如何適應(yīng)和調(diào)節(jié)體溫。
9. thermometer:溫度計(jì),用于測(cè)量體溫的工具,可以幫助診斷和治療熱相關(guān)疾病。
10. sunstroke:日射病,一種嚴(yán)重的中暑癥狀,通常發(fā)生在暴露于強(qiáng)烈陽(yáng)光下且沒(méi)有適當(dāng)降溫時(shí)。

例句:
1. He was suffering from heat exhaustion after working in the sun all day.
2. She had to rest for a while after experiencing heat exhaustion symptoms.
3. The doctor advised him to take some simple measures to prevent heat exhaustion.
4. It"s important to stay hydrated in hot weather to prevent heat exhaustion.
5. Heat exhaustion is a serious condition that can lead to serious health problems if not treated promptly.
6. Children are particularly vulnerable to heat-related illnesses like heat exhaustion.
7. The hot weather caused a number of heat exhaustion incidents at the local sports event.
英文小作文:
Summer heat can be unbearable, especially for those who work or play outdoors for long periods of time. Heat exhaustion is a common problem during hot weather, and it"s important to take precautions to prevent it.
If you experience symptoms like lightheadedness, fatigue, and hot, flushed skin, it could be heat exhaustion. It"s recommended to rest in the shade, drink plenty of water, and seek medical attention if necessary.
Preventing heat exhaustion is even more important for children and elderly people, who are more vulnerable to the effects of heat. Keeping hydrated and taking breaks in the shade can help to avoid this summer health hazard.
